Common Electrical Issues in Whitestone Homes and Businesses

Properties throughout Whitestone, regardless of their age or size, can experience a range of electrical problems. Recognizing these issues early can prevent more serious damage and ensure your safety. Some of the most common concerns include:

  • Frequent tripping of circuit breakers or blowing fuses, indicating overloaded circuits or faulty wiring.
  • Dimming or flickering lights, which can be a sign of loose connections or voltage issues.
  • Sparks or buzzing sounds coming from outlets or switches, a clear danger signal.
  • Outdated or insufficient electrical panels that can’t handle the demands of modern appliances and electronics.
  • The need for additional outlets or dedicated circuits for new equipment or renovations.
  • Safety concerns such as exposed wiring or non-compliant installations, especially in older properties.

Estimated Costs for Electrician Services in Whitestone, New York

The cost of electrician services in Whitestone can vary widely depending on the complexity of the job, the materials needed, and the specific electrician’s rates. Below is a general estimate for common services. It’s always recommended to get a detailed quote from your chosen electrician.

Service Estimated Cost Range
Hourly Rate $90 – $175
Service Call Fee (Diagnostic) $75 – $150
Replace an Electrical Outlet $150 – $300
Install a Light Fixture $200 – $500
Install a Ceiling Fan $300 – $600
Upgrade Electrical Panel (200 Amp) $1,500 – $4,000+
Rewiring a Single Room $1,000 – $3,000+
Install a Generator Transfer Switch $500 – $1,500

Note: These are estimates and actual costs may vary significantly. Factors like the specific brand of materials, the accessibility of wiring, and the complexity of the existing system can influence pricing. Emergency services may also incur higher rates.

Frequently Asked Questions for Whitestone Residents

Q1: How do I know if my electrical panel needs an upgrade in my Whitestone home?

A1: You might need an upgrade if you frequently blow fuses or trip breakers, have older wiring (older than 30 years), experience dimming lights when using high-powered appliances, or if your panel is rusty or damaged. Homes in Whitestone with older construction are more prone to needing panel upgrades to safely accommodate modern electrical demands.

Q2: What are the signs of faulty wiring that I should look out for?

A2: Signs of faulty wiring include flickering lights, outlets that are warm to the touch, a burning smell near outlets or switches, discolored outlets, or consistently tripping breakers. These are serious indicators and warrant an immediate inspection by a qualified electrician.

Q3: If I’m planning a renovation in Whitestone, when should I involve an electrician?

A3: It’s best to involve an electrician early in the renovation planning process. They can help assess the existing electrical capacity, advise on power needs for new appliances or layouts, ensure proper placement of outlets and fixtures, and help you budget for necessary electrical upgrades, compliance, and potential permit requirements.

Local Electrical Age Data for Whitestone

The median home in Whitestone was built in 1963 — placing most of the area's housing stock in the possible aluminum branch wiring era. Aluminum branch-circuit wiring was widely installed in homes built during the 1965–1973 period as a cost-saving alternative to copper. Aluminum expands and contracts more than copper, loosening connections over time and creating arc-fault fire hazards. Affected homes require either full rewiring or approved remediation at every device (AFCI breakers or CO/ALR-rated outlets and switches). Source: U.S. Census Bureau, American Community Survey, median year structure built.

Do I need a permit for Electrician in New York?

In New York, permits are generally required for panel upgrades, new circuits, rewiring, and any work that changes the electrical system's structure. A licensed electrician will pull the permit as part of the job. Unpermitted electrical work can create insurance issues and complicate a future home sale.

New York Electricity Rates & Electrical Upgrades

New York residents pay an average of 26.4¢/kWh for residential electricity (2025) — above the national average. At this rate, a modern panel upgrade that enables whole-home efficiency improvements (heat pump HVAC, EV charging, solar-ready wiring) has a stronger economic case than in lower-rate states. Source: U.S. Energy Information Administration, Electric Power Monthly, 2025.
